Joey Clemente is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Oncology and Radiation. According to data from OpenAlex, Joey Clemente has authored 4 papers receiving a total of 9 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 1 paper in Oncology and 1 paper in Radiation. Recurrent topics in Joey Clemente's work include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(3 papers), Prostate Cancer Treatment and Research (2 papers) and Radiomics and Machine Learning in Medical Imaging (1 paper). Joey Clemente is often cited by papers focused on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(3 papers), Prostate Cancer Treatment and Research (2 papers) and Radiomics and Machine Learning in Medical Imaging (1 paper). Joey Clemente collaborates with scholars based in Spain and United Kingdom. Joey Clemente's co-authors include E. Villafranca, J. Mengual, Saurabh Singh, Daniel C. Alexander, Víctor Manuel Becerra‐Muñoz, Susan Heavey, Baris Kanber, A. Zapatero, J. L. Mora and Carlos González and has published in prestigious journals such as European Journal of Radiology, Clinical & Translational Oncology and Revista de medicina de la Universidad de Navarra.
